Welcome to on-call for the Glimmerpane design system! Our snapshot tests live in the `snapcheck` suite and run on every merge to main. If a UI component changes visually, the diff bot flags it — usually it's an intentional tweak, so just approve the new baseline. If it's 2am and snapshots are failing across the board, it's almost always a font-loading race, not your problem. To unlock the baseline store and re-approve snapshots in bulk, use the recovery passphrase below.

recovery phrase for tahag-taguf: wenix-caswyn

Subject: Shuttle-Bus Gate — Contractor Access

Hello all,

From Monday, contractors working on the Eastfield annexe should arrive via the shuttle-bus gate on Perrin Lane rather than the main lobby of Halder Park. The shuttle runs every twenty minutes from the park-and-ride. Sign in at the gatehouse kiosk and collect a hi-vis lanyard. To open the pedestrian turnstile beside the gatehouse, enter the code below.

turnstile pass: bdg-TXR-4

Handover note — Crumbwheel order cutoffs.

Welcome aboard. The bakery cutoff rule in Crumbwheel closes same-day orders at 14:00 local to each storefront, not UTC — this has bitten us twice. Holiday overrides live in the calendar service and take precedence silently, so always check there first when a cutoff looks wrong. To unlock the calendar service's admin console after a restart, enter the recovery passphrase below.

vault phrase of bagap-bahaf = silion-pelox-sorox-casdor-quenwyn-fraax-eliox-praael-kelion-quenvan-kasox-rusael-norius-belvan

## Deployment

Tidewisp, our stale-branch cleanup bot, runs as a single container on the Moorgate build cluster. Deploy by tagging a release; the pipeline handles rollout. One instance only — concurrent runs will double-delete branches. It reads its settings from the environment at boot, nothing hot-reloads. Before your first deploy, verify your environment matches the reference configuration below.

config for yadug-kawep:
ralwyn:
  log_level: debug
  metrics_host: metrics.ralwyn.qorvellabs.internal
  pool_size: 4